Our high-performance automotive pistons are precision-engineered components designed for the rigorous demands of reciprocating engines, pumps, and compressors. They operate within cylinders, forming a critical gas-tight seal via piston rings to efficiently convert expanding gas pressure into mechanical force. These pistons serve as the heart of motion in numerous industries. In automotive and transport, they are fundamental to engines powering everything from passenger sedans and light trucks to heavy-duty commercial vehicles and buses. The agricultural sector relies on them for tractors, combines, and irrigation pumps, while construction depends on their robustness in excavators, bulldozers, and cranes. Marine applications utilize them for inboard and outboard engine propulsion. Furthermore, they are essential in the power generation sector for generator sets and across general manufacturing in various industrial pumps and compressor systems, proving their versatility and critical role in keeping machinery operational.
